Description
English: 5 pieces of a cast copper alloy bell dating to the late Medieval or Post-Medieval period. It has broken into many pieces, these are only a small part of the bell. It has incised decoration on the exterior surface.
Depicted place (County of findspot) Norfolk
Date between 1400 and 1700

The Portable Antiquities Scheme (PAS) is a voluntary programme run by the United Kingdom government to record the increasing numbers of small finds of archaeological interest found by members of the public. The scheme started in 1997 and now covers most of England and Wales. Finds are published at https://finds.org.uk
